    Job Summary

    Summary :   Responsible for patient food service on assigned units, including menu selections, tray assembly, tray delivery and pick-up, special requests and needs, and in-between meal food delivery.

    Essential Duties and Responsibilities :

    • Exhibits a friendly, caring attitude to patients when taking menu selections, delivering trays, inquiring during catering rounds and retrieving trays.
    • Takes patients menu selections prior to each meal.
    • Complies with dietary restrictions on special, modified diets to ensure optimal food preferences are met within guidelines of diet order limitations.
    • Offers alternatives to menu as allowed on prescribed diet in accordance with food allergies and sensitivities, cultural, ethnic and religious preferences, when patient inquires or needs additional selections.
    • Assembles trays according to patients' menu selections on tray tickets in a timely and accurate manner.
    • Interacts with nursing staff to ensure patients' diet prescriptions are accurate and patients' food needs are met.
    • Retrieves trays from patients' rooms.
    • Maintains accurate and current information for each patient on assigned unit(s).
    • Assists dietitian with monitoring of patients who are NPO, on liquid diets or have a calorie count ordered.
    • Communicates any patient related problems / concerns to appropriate personnel in a timely manner following departmental procedures.
    • Adheres to facility confidentiality and patients' rights policy as outlined in the facility's HIPAA policies and procedures.
    • Contributes to patient satisfaction goals by providing quality service.
    • Complies with federal, state and local health and sanitation regulations and department sanitation procedures.
    • Maintains a clean, sanitary working environment.
    • Follows HACCP guidelines when assembling and distributing food supplies to ensure quality and safety of food supply.
    • Completes all daily, weekly or monthly reports as outlined in the corporate policies and procedures on a timely basis meeting all prescribed deadlines.
    • Identifies and utilizes cleaning chemicals following directions recommended by manufacturers and per MSDS sheets.
    • Utilizes equipment in performing job functions according to department's safety procedures.
    • Follows facility and departmental safety policies and procedures to include incident reporting.
    • Follows facility and departmental infection control policies and procedures.
    • Follows the facility's protocols for Hazardous Materials and Waste Program.
    • Adheres to Emergency Preparedness Program and Life Safety Program. Participates in drills, as appropriate.
    • Performs other duties as assigned.
